Public Notice: December 15, 2011 Indian Community Development Block Grant (ICDBG) Program Community Development Statement Confederated Tribes of Grand Ronde Food Bank Project Tribal Council met on Dec. 1, 2011, and reviewed project sugges tions received from community meetings and surveys and directed staff to prepare an ICDBG application for the design and construc tion of a food bank. The proposed 3,000 sq. ft. food bank project will provide a community services facility designed as a food bank and capable of handling and meeting USDA commodities program re quirements for our community. The application will be submitted by the Grand Ronde Tribe working in cooperation with the Grand Ronde Community Resource Center, which will operate the food bank in the proposed facility. The estimated cost is $667,000, including $500,000 requested from the proposed Indian Community Development Block Grant and $167,000 from the Tribe less any potential NAHASDA eligible assistance that the Grand Ronde Tribal Housing Authority may be able to provide. A facility operation and maintenance budget of $30,000 a year is planned.
